Hi All,

I'm in my 14th week and off from work. Though I am taking healthy home made food and eating almost a balanced diet, I don't think the quantity is enough. I don't have any hunger pangs and cravings or aversions.

I just feel that my appetite is small. I do not feel like drinking water. There was a time when I would take about 14-16 glasses a day. Now it has reduced to less than half. Eating is also mechanincal and I eat just because I have to. Is it normal to have a small appetite at this stage also?

I seem to have been avoiding fulids for the past few days. I just don't feel up to it. Also I am off from work till the end of this week. My stamina has also decreased. I think going back to work might help in fixing my appetite and stamina. However, as of now, I am worried that I will not be able to handle the stress at work with this kind of appetite and stamina.

Can anybody suggest ways to improve the appetite.
